Save those tiny zip lock bags when you come across them - holding samples, etc. They can be re-cycled for all sorts of things - holding sewing kits or eye glass repair kits or (if they are bigger) groupings of cosmetic samples. Or you can use them to present bits of jewelry as gifts. They really are useful!
